brow
n 1: the part of the face above the eyes [synonym: {brow},
{forehead}]
2: the arch of hair above each eye [synonym: {eyebrow}, {brow},
{supercilium}]
3: the peak of a hill; "the sun set behind the brow of distant
hills" [synonym: {hilltop}, {brow}]

Brow \Brow\ (brou), n. [OE. browe, bruwe, AS. br[=u]; akin to
AS. br[=ae]w, bre['a]w, eyelid, OFries. br[=e], D. braauw,
Icel. br[=a], br[=u]n, OHG. pr[=a]wa, G. braue, OSlav.
br[u^]v[i^], Russ. brove, Ir. brai, Ir. & Gael. abhra, Armor.
abrant, Gr. 'ofry`s, Skr. bhr[=u]. Cf. {Bray} a bank,
{Bridge}.]
1. The prominent ridge over the eye, with the hair that
covers it, forming an arch above the orbit.
[1913 Webster]

And his arched brow, pulled o'er his eyes,
With solemn proof proclaims him wise. --Churchill.
[1913 Webster]

2. The hair that covers the brow (ridge over the eyes); the
eyebrow.
[1913 Webster]

'T is not your inky brows, your brack silk hair.
--Shak.
[1913 Webster]

3. The forehead; as, a feverish brow.
[1913 Webster]

Beads of sweat have stood upon thy brow. --Shak.
[1913 Webster]

4. The general air of the countenance.
[1913 Webster]

To whom thus Satan with contemptuous brow. --Milton.
[1913 Webster]

He told them with a masterly brow. --Milton.
[1913 Webster]

5. The edge or projecting upper part of a steep place; as,
the brow of a precipice; the brow of a hill.
[1913 Webster]

{To bend the brow}, {To knit the brows}, to frown; to scowl.
